This is an interesting compilation of connected characters across three prolific authors.
Against The Heart by Kat Martin
She's trying to make a better life for her daughter. First step get away from the deadbeat that was a one night stand and only comes around when he's trying to shake Meri down for money. Second step, find a way to make money to continue the escape plan. Third step, fall for Ian, he'll protect you.
Shaken by Rebecca Zanetti
Michelle has the worst luck, starting with her mother whose drug addition forced her into foster care. The only good thing that came out of that was seeing connections with her fellow neglected kids. And when things get dangerous she knows she can call in them, but she doesn't expect Evan to be her rescuer. Now as they try to resolve the situation the past hurts are surfacing and it's time to decide if forgiveness is possible. Can Michelle trust Evan not to hurt her again?
Echoes of the Past by Alexandra Ivy
Detective Gray Hawkins is back in Seattle a place he didn't think he'd returned after he left two years ago. But when rumors of corruption in the police force service surface he's the perfect one to dig in. Melanie Cassidy is a huge advocate for the kids she works with she just didn't expect to stop kidnappers from taking one of them. And the unexpected rescuer of Gray was definitely a twist. Now they have to work together to find out who is threatening the kid and uncover the corruption.

This is a collection of three shorter stories by three amazing authors. The three stories are connected to each other by using the same characters in each one in some way.

Against the Heart is the first one by Kat Martin. What I liked about this one was the human connection angle. This story was more than just Ian and Meri meeting and falling in love, but also about Ian’s father, Daniel, finding his way back to life after his wife’s passing.

Shaken by Rebecca Zanetti is the second book. I loved this one the most for the romance and the relationship development between Michelle and Evan. They fell in love as teenagers when they were in the same foster home for a short period of time. The fell apart because Evan was in the military and Michelle had a hard time dealing with the dangerous aspects of his career. And Evan showed no signs of ever leaving. Now Evan is a small-town sheriff and has every intention of winning Michelle back. And there was plenty of action.

Echoes of the Past by Alexandra Ivy is the third book. This one came out on top in terms of action and excitement. I enjoyed the journey of reconnection between Melanie and Gray as well. This story was pretty fast-paced and offered plenty of thrills.

The styles of the three authors worked well together to make this entire book very enjoyable.
